Web6 aug. 2024 · Banned in Ohio: None; free state with no major restrictions on guns, ammo or parts. Note for Ohio: A permit is necessary to possess “dangerous ordnance:” any automatic or short-barreled firearm, zip guns, supporessors or parts to convert a firearm into a dangerous ordnance.
